When I was getting ready to visit Botswana, everyone recommended that I read this book (and it's sequels). I wan't really that excited about the idea since this book is about a young African woman but written by an old Scottish* man. BUT, when I got to Botswana, a local woman raved about it and said that it really captured the culture and feel of Botswana. So, I decided to give it a try. She was right!! I can see a lot of the culture and descriptors even though I have only been here for a short time. As far as the mystery goes, it's not that strong, but this is a book that you read in order to "travel" somewhere new.
*It turns out that Alexander McCall Smith was born in Zimbabwe and worked as a law professor at the University of Botswana. Only now does he live in Scotland.
